I[CII]/IFIR as a function of the distance d from the main star of all HII regions found in the investigated clouds. At small d, I[CII]/IFIR drops to 10−6 − 10−4, depending on the regions and snapshots. At larger radii, the ratio is ~10−2 at early stages, and ~10−3 at later stages. The drop of the ratio at later stages is mostly due to the overall dust heating in the entire cloud caused by the various stars which have already formed.
